diff options
author | Daniel Høyer Iversen <mail@dahoiv.net> | 2019-04-25T07·39+0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2019-04-25T07·39+0200 |
commit | 1d6d8d2aee6e221aa3383e4078b19b7b95397f43 (patch) | |
tree | c34013a65729b7816f1bf1bb1111c1c68cc3f9c1 | |
parent | db2dec13e1a628382d1544f49a86b5082d8ed7fd (diff) | |
parent | c393cf6079ccaa24afd61a8e81c051251198f73b (diff) |
Merge pull request #234 from pommi/cli-python3
broadlink_cli: python3 support
-rwxr-xr-x | cli/broadlink_cli | 44 |
1 files changed, 22 insertions, 22 deletions
diff --git a/cli/broadlink_cli b/cli/broadlink_cli index 54f02a0787ba..a4d9a20d24d7 100755 --- a/cli/broadlink_cli +++ b/cli/broadlink_cli @@ -102,11 +102,11 @@ if args.host or args.device: if args.convert: data = bytearray.fromhex(''.join(args.data)) durations = to_microseconds(data) - print format_durations(durations) + print(format_durations(durations)) if args.temperature: - print dev.check_temperature() + print(dev.check_temperature()) if args.energy: - print dev.get_energy() + print(dev.get_energy()) if args.sensors: try: data = dev.check_sensors() @@ -114,7 +114,7 @@ if args.sensors: data = {} data['temperature'] = dev.check_temperature() for key in data: - print "{} {}".format(key, data[key]) + print("{} {}".format(key, data[key])) if args.send: data = durations_to_broadlink(parse_durations(' '.join(args.data))) \ if args.durations else bytearray.fromhex(''.join(args.data)) @@ -122,7 +122,7 @@ if args.send: if args.learn or args.learnfile: dev.enter_learning() data = None - print "Learning..." + print("Learning...") timeout = 30 while (data is None) and (timeout > 0): time.sleep(2) @@ -133,51 +133,51 @@ if args.learn or args.learnfile: if args.durations \ else ''.join(format(x, '02x') for x in bytearray(data)) if args.learn: - print learned + print(learned) if args.learnfile: - print "Saving to {}".format(args.learnfile) + print("Saving to {}".format(args.learnfile)) with open(args.learnfile, "w") as text_file: text_file.write(learned) else: - print "No data received..." + print("No data received...") if args.check: if dev.check_power(): - print '* ON *' + print('* ON *') else: - print '* OFF *' + print('* OFF *') if args.checknl: if dev.check_nightlight(): - print '* ON *' + print('* ON *') else: - print '* OFF *' + print('* OFF *') if args.turnon: dev.set_power(True) if dev.check_power(): - print '== Turned * ON * ==' + print('== Turned * ON * ==') else: - print '!! Still OFF !!' + print('!! Still OFF !!') if args.turnoff: dev.set_power(False) if dev.check_power(): - print '!! Still ON !!' + print('!! Still ON !!') else: - print '== Turned * OFF * ==' + print('== Turned * OFF * ==') if args.turnnlon: dev.set_nightlight(True) if dev.check_nightlight(): - print '== Turned * ON * ==' + print('== Turned * ON * ==') else: - print '!! Still OFF !!' + print('!! Still OFF !!') if args.turnnloff: dev.set_nightlight(False) if dev.check_nightlight(): - print '!! Still ON !!' + print('!! Still ON !!') else: - print '== Turned * OFF * ==' + print('== Turned * OFF * ==') if args.switch: if dev.check_power(): dev.set_power(False) - print '* Switch to OFF *' + print('* Switch to OFF *') else: dev.set_power(True) - print '* Switch to ON *' + print('* Switch to ON *') |